Wish (2023)
An animation movie starring Ariana DeBose, Chris Pine and Alan Tudyk
Asha, a sharp-witted idealist, makes a wish so powerful that it is answered by a cosmic force - a little ball of boundless energy called Star. Together, Asha and Star confront a most formidable foe - the ruler of Rosas, King Magnifico - to save her community and prove that when the will of one courageous human connects with the magic of the stars, wondrous things can happen.
Dungeons & Dragons: Honor Among Thieves (2023)
A rated PG-13 fantasy movie starring Chris Pine, Michelle Rodriguez and Justice Smith
Looking to rob a conman who stole all his loot, a thief gathers a party consisting of a barbarian, a wizard, and a druid to venture forth to foil the conman who now presides as the Lord of Neverwinter.
The Flash (2023)
An rated PG-13 action movie starring Ezra Miller, Sasha Calle and Michael Keaton
When his attempt to save his family inadvertently alters the future, Barry Allen becomes trapped in a reality in which General Zod has returned and there are no Super Heroes to turn to. In order to save the world that he is in and return to the future that he knows, Barry's only hope is to race for his life. But will making the ultimate sacrifice be enough to reset the universe?

The Watchers (2024)
A horror movie starring Dakota Fanning, Georgina Campbell and Olwen Fouéré
When Mina, a 28-year-old artist, finds shelter after getting stranded in an expansive, untouched forest in western Ireland, she unknowingly becomes trapped alongside three strangers that are watched and stalked by mysterious creatures each night.
